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Academy Lanes (Brownwood, TX)
Academy Lanes is situated in the heart of Brownwood, Texas, a city known for its strong community spirit and accessible amenities. Located at 1101 Austin Avenue, it’s easily reachable by car via major thoroughfares like State Highway 279. Parking is generally ample directly at the venue, alleviating major traffic concerns for most visitors. The nearest major airport serving Brownwood is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port (DFW), which is approximately a two-hour drive northeast, requiring a rental car or pre-arranged transport. For those flying into a closer, smaller airport, Abilene Regional Airport (ABI) is about an hour and 15 minutes northwest. Rideshare services are available in Brownwood, though their frequency can vary, especially during off-peak hours. Smart arrival involves checking event schedules if applicable, or simply planning to arrive 10–15 minutes before your desired activity to smoothly transition from vehicle to venue entrance.

Weather & Seasons at Academy Lanes
- Winter: Winter in Brownwood typically brings cool to mild temperatures, with daytime highs often in the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it. Overnight lows can dip into the 30s, occasionally bringing frost or light freezes. Visitors should pack layers, including sweaters or light jackets, and comfortable long pants. Indoor activities like bowling are perfect for cooler days. Rainfall is moderate, and while snow is rare, it can occur occasionally, usually not accumulating significantly but causing brief travel disruptions.
- Spring & early summer: Spring weather is generally pleasant with warming temperatures, ranging from the 60s to the 80s Fahrenheit. This season is ideal for exploring Brownwood's outdoor attractions. Light jackets or long-sleeved shirts are usually sufficient for mornings and evenings, while shorts and t-shirts are comfortable during the day. Spring can bring more frequent rain showers, so packing a light umbrella or waterproof jacket is advisable. This period is perfect for enjoying both indoor and outdoor activities with comfortable conditions.
- Mid-summer: Summer in Brownwood is characterized by significant heat, with daytime temperatures frequently reaching the 90s and sometimes exceeding 100 degrees Fahrenheit. Humidity can also be high, making it feel even warmer. Visitors should prioritize lightweight, breathable clothing like shorts, t-shirts, and sundresses. Staying hydrated is crucial if engaging in any outdoor activities. Most visitors opt for air-conditioned indoor venues like Academy Lanes during the hottest parts of the day. Evening temperatures offer some relief but remain warm.
- Fall season: Fall offers a delightful transition with comfortable temperatures, generally ranging from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it. This season is considered by many to be the most pleasant for exploring the region. Layers are recommended, with sweaters, light jackets, and comfortable pants being ideal. Outdoor activities are highly enjoyable, and the fall foliage can add scenic beauty. Rainfall decreases compared to spring, making it a prime time for outdoor events and enjoying the local scenery.
- Rain & snow: Rainfall is moderate throughout the year in Brownwood, with higher chances during spring. Thunderstorms can occur, sometimes bringing heavy downpours and lightning, which can temporarily impact outdoor plans and driving conditions. Snow is a rare occurrence; when it does happen, it typically results in light accumulations that melt quickly. Regardless of precipitation, indoor venues like Academy Lanes remain unaffected and offer a consistent entertainment option. Visitors should monitor local weather forecasts for any significant weather advisories.
